Q: Is 25,254,250 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 25,254,250 is a composite number.

Why is 25,254,250 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 25,254,250 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 7 10 14 25 35 50 70 125 175 250 350 875 1,750 14,431 28,862 72,155 101,017 144,310 202,034 360,775 505,085 721,550 1,010,170 1,803,875 2,525,425 3,607,750 5,050,850 12,627,125 and 25,254,250, with no remainder.

Since 25,254,250 cannot be divided by just 1 and 25,254,250, it is a composite number.
